The Unsexy Truth: Why Rules Aren’t Just Red Tape
Let’s be honest. Clicking on a dense “Rules & Guidelines” page often feels like homework. It’s tempting to skim, skip, and dive straight into posting. But this is where the first critical mistake happens. Ignoring the rules is like showing up to a potluck without knowing the theme – you might bring something great, but it could also be wildly inappropriate.
Avoiding Foot-in-Mouth Moments: Every community has its norms, sensitivities, and off-limit topics. Posting an affiliate link where they’re banned? Debating politics in a strictly apolitical group? Sharing personal information against guidelines? Reading the rules prevents these instant community faux pas that can get you warned, muted, or even banned before you’ve even found your footing. It’s basic respect for the established space.
Understanding the “Why”: Good rules aren’t arbitrary. They exist to protect members, maintain quality, foster productive discussion, and uphold the community’s core purpose. Knowing why self-promotion is limited, why certain language is discouraged, or why content needs specific tags helps you align your actions with the community’s health. You become part of the solution, not a potential problem.
Navigating Effectively: Rules often contain essential logistical information: How to format posts? Where to post specific types of questions? How to report issues? Who are the moderators? Knowing this saves you time and frustration. You post in the right place, tag things correctly, and know exactly how to get help if needed.
Building Credibility: Members and moderators notice who takes the time to understand the environment. Demonstrating that you’ve read the rules instantly marks you as someone who cares about contributing positively, making others more receptive to your posts and ideas.
Beyond the Basics: The Golden Nuggets in Community Highlights
While rules set the boundaries, community highlights show you the heart and aspiration. These are often pinned posts, featured sections, newsletters, or regular threads showcasing exceptional contributions.
The Blueprint for Success: Highlight posts are your cheat sheet. They answer the unspoken question: “What does great look like here?” Is it incredibly detailed technical answers? Witty, engaging discussions? Beautifully crafted creative work? Thoughtful, supportive responses? Seeing what gets celebrated gives you a crystal-clear model of the behavior and content the community truly values. It shows you the quality bar.
Discovering Hidden Gems & Trends: Highlights often surface fantastic discussions, resources, or members you might have missed. They can reveal trending topics, showcase expert members worth following, or point to invaluable guides and FAQs buried deep in the archives. It’s curated excellence delivered straight to you.
Understanding Nuance & Culture: Rules tell you what not to do. Highlights show you how to excel. They reveal the subtle cultural nuances – the in-jokes, the preferred communication style (formal vs. casual?), the types of humor that land well. Seeing how top contributors interact and frame their ideas provides context that rules alone cannot.
Finding Inspiration & Connection: Seeing others recognized can be genuinely inspiring. It shows what’s possible within the community framework. It can spark new ideas for your own contributions and help you connect with like-minded members whose highlighted work resonates with you. It fosters a sense of shared achievement and pride.
Putting it Together: Your Community Engagement Toolkit
1. Make it Mandatory: Before posting anything, find the rules. Seriously. Bookmark them. Treat them as essential reading, not an optional afterthought. Skimming isn’t enough; aim for comprehension.
2. Seek Out the Highlights: Actively look for the community’s “Hall of Fame.” Is it a pinned “Post of the Month” thread? A “Featured Content” section? A moderator-run “Community Spotlight” newsletter? Subscribe to it, check it regularly.
3. Analyze, Don’t Just Browse: When looking at highlights, ask yourself:
What specifically made this post/contribution stand out? (Depth, clarity, creativity, helpfulness, positivity?)
How does it align with the stated rules?
What can I learn from this about the community’s taste and expectations?
Who are the members consistently featured, and what can I learn from their approach?
4. Engage with Highlights: Don’t just passively read. Upvote the highlight post itself! Leave a genuine, thoughtful comment congratulating the featured member or explaining what you appreciated about their contribution. This signals active participation and appreciation for community standards.
5. Use Them as a Compass: Let the rules and highlights guide your contributions. Aim to emulate the quality and spirit of the featured posts while strictly adhering to the guidelines. Ask yourself before posting: “Does this align with the best examples I’ve seen? Does it respect the rules?”
